This course is designed to help the student to apply principles of Biblical Counseling learned in other counseling courses. Effective Biblical Counseling is not just a matter of knowing what the Bible teaches about counseling related issues; it is also a matter of knowing how to effectively use that information in order to help people. In other words, counseling involves skill in practice as well as knowledge of Biblical content. Prerequisites: 34300, 34330, 34335
